Market Growth and Projections
The global stair lifts market is on an impressive growth trajectory, with projections suggesting a rise from approximately US$ 1,071.3 million in 2025 to US$ 1,673.8 million by 2032. This translates to a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.6% during the forecast period. Following a historical CAGR of 5.8% from 2019 to 2024, this growth signals a continuing demand for mobility solutions as the global population ages. Europe is the leading market, contributing over 30% of total revenue in 2025, driven by stringent accessibility regulations and an increasing elderly demographic.
Product Dynamics of the Stair Lift Market
The stair lifts market can be categorized by product type, installation location, and end-user demographics. Straight stair lifts account for about 45% of the market share, favored for their affordability and ease of installation. Conversely, curved stair lifts are emerging as the fastest-growing segment, responding to the increasing need for customized solutions in architecturally complex homes.
Key Product Categories:
- Straight Stair Lifts: Economically viable and suitable for straight staircases.
- Curved Stair Lifts: Customizable to fit intricate stair designs, ideal for upscale residential and institutional settings.
- Outdoor Stair Lifts: Engineered for durability and weather resistance, facilitating mobility in outdoor environments.

Regional Insights
Europe
Europe remains the most developed market, bolstered by a high proportion of elderly residents and rigorous accessibility regulations. Countries with strong governmental support for mobility aids, like the UK, Germany, and France, showcase the importance of reimbursement frameworks in fostering growth.
North America
North America, particularly the United States, demonstrates significant demand for stair lifts, driven by reimbursement policies tied to Medicare and Medicaid. Canada contributes to the regional growth through government-funded programs focused on accessibility solutions.
Asia Pacific
Emerging as the fastest-growing market, the Asia Pacific region is witnessing a remarkable CAGR of approximately 8.6%. Rapid urbanization and a rising elderly population in countries such as India, China, and Japan are key growth drivers, supported by government initiatives promoting accessibility and healthcare infrastructure investments.
Market Drivers
The primary catalyst for growth in the stair lifts market is the aging global population. Projections indicate that the number of individuals aged 65 and over will nearly double by 2027, significantly boosting demand for mobility solutions tailored for aging-in-place strategies. Furthermore, regulatory compliance demands for accessibility features in public and residential buildings are fostering market expansion.
Technological advancements also play a crucial role, with manufacturers increasingly incorporating battery-operated systems, smart safety sensors, and custom-fit rail technologies to enhance user experience and confidence.
Challenges Faced by the Market
However, several challenges could impede the broader adoption of stair lifts. One significant hurdle is the limited adaptability of infrastructure, particularly in older buildings where staircases may not conform to standard dimensions. This limitation often necessitates custom installations, increasing overall costs.
Another obstacle is the shortage of skilled installation technicians, particularly in emerging markets. Given that the installation of stair lifts entails rigorous safety checks and precise alignments, a lack of trained professionals could delay installation processes.

Recent Developments
In a testament to the market’s dynamic nature, leading firms are continually evolving their product offerings. For instance, Stannah Lifts Holdings Ltd. launched its dedicated homelift brand, Uplifts, in April 2024, while Acorn Stairlifts paired with John Preston to improve regional accessibility in Northern Ireland in 2025.
